Butterscotch Bars Recipe
These Butterscotch Bars are thick and chewy with an irresistibly rich, sweet, salty, and buttery flavor. It’s a perfect make-ahead dessert for any time of the year.

Servings: 24 3" x 1.5" bars

- 1 cup Butter room temperature
- ⅔ cup Sugar
- ⅔ cup Light Brown Sugar packed and leveled
- 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ract
- ½ teaspoon Salt
- 2 large Eggs
- 1 teaspoon Baking Soda
- 2 cups All-Purpose Flour
- 2 cups Butterscotch Chips
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
Lightly spray a 9" x 13" baking dish with nonstick cooking spray and set aside.
In a medium mixing bowl, cream together the room temperature butter, sugar, and brown sugar using an electric mixer, or in the bowl of a stand mixer with the paddle attachment. Beat until light and fluffy, or about 2 minutes.
Slowly add the eggs and vanilla, mixing on low to combine.
In a separate bowl, whisk together the baking soda and flour, and add into the butter mixture, mixing on low just until combined.
Spread batter into your prepared baking pan, then sprinkle the butterscotch chips evenly over the top.
Bake in a preheated oven for about 5 minutes, then remove from the oven and use an offset spatula or butter knife to swirl the butterscotch in a circular pattern through the batter.
Return the cookie bars to the oven and bake an additional 12-15 minutes, or until the edges are just slightly golden.
Remove from the oven and let cool completely before cutting into bars . Enjoy!
